While ideal staff transitions feature seamless handovers and robust documentation, reality often involves significant knowledge gaps and staffing shortages. Following several retirements in UNLV Libraries’ Acquisitions and Discovery Services, our team faced the challenge of assuming new roles with incomplete legacy documentation. Rather than recreating the past, we focused on rebuilding workflows centered on current service impact. This presentation discusses our process of analyzing library needs and consulting stakeholders to redefine these workflows. Central to our success was leveraging existing staff skill sets while fostering a supportive culture for navigating the unknown.

Attendees will learn to identify institutional knowledge gaps and engage stakeholders to define evolving process needs.
Attendees will understand how to foster a collaborative culture that supports staff through turnover-induced change.
